Transaction 154abf1534ee7702e8202a17630089580011bc6c024f744093d5ddaada947c5a
1 Input
1 Output
-
154abf1534ee7702e8202a17630089580011bc6c024f744093d5ddaada947c5a:0
- value
- 3523270
- script pubkey
- OP_0 OP_PUSHBYTES_20 525db7c3c4d904391f896b38767fd9d43240e02d
- address
- bc1q2fwm0s7ymyzrj8ufdvu8vl7e6seypcpdpxvspm